Does that means I need to install 2 copies of GTA? One for Online, one for LSPD?
I suggest use the "Mods" folder and copy any file outside it into the "Mods" folder, reflecting the directory it used. Remove the ASI loader and DON'T RUN the RagePluginHook.exe when you want to play GTA Online.
That will solve your provlem.
Oh that's a good idea. Yeah 150GB of SSD is madness.
So I'll try install LSPD into a "MODS" folder. and remove the ASI loader as you mentioned.
